Planting the First Seeds


First Lady Michelle Obama is a revolutionary! She's leading the way to a new American diet, one that's organic, local and healthy.

By bringing children into the White House garden to harvest the early veggie crop and to help cook their own lunch this week, Michelle Obama is inspiring others to look at the health implications of our national food policies.

She pointed out that nearly one third of our children are obese and that roughly the same percentage will eventually have diabetes. She said "those numbers are unacceptable." She called for new menus and food sources for school lunch and breakfast programs, where many American kids get most of their daily nutrition.

It's so heartening to see a First Lady who sees the crisis we're in and who will be a big influence in reaping a healthier, more promising future for our nation. Go Michelle!
